What is Reading International, Inc.'s investing cash flow?
Reading International, Inc. (RDI) reported investing cash flow of -$545K in Q1 2026.
How has Reading International, Inc.'s investing cash flow changed year-over-year?
Reading International, Inc.'s investing cash flow decreased by 103.0% year-over-year, from $17.88M to -$545K.
What does investing cash flow mean?
Total net cash provided by or used in investing activities — capex, acquisitions, investment purchases/sales, and other investing items.
